- toggle quoted message Show quoted textHi,I don't think the catchup option works for old backups unfortunately. SVs can only catch up iff they are within the cometbft and sequencer pruning interval of 30 days. So for the main goal here of testing that SVs preserve backups essentially forever, this is not suited. On top of that there are extra complications: Catchup is relatively slow and an SV is not gonna be able to mint rewards while it is catching up.So I think some option where SVs compare data between each other from their backups without actually trying to run a full node against them is more realistic. We'll need to define how exactly that comparison is going to work for cometbft, sequencer, mediator and participant though.On Tue, Mar 4, 2025 at 8:18 AM Stanislav German-Evtushenko via lists.sync.global <stasge=sbisecsol.com@...> wrote:Yiannis,This could've been an option however there are some challenges:1) there should be a way to restore data from the network inception till one month before current time without gaps2) catching up could be pretty slow (something like 1/10 of real time)Another option could be picking a few arbitrary (somewhat random) points in time, fetching states at those points from the archive and comparing them to some references. Hi Itail,
I think we need to develop a backup prover. The prover can be run by any SV. Periodically the prover will raise a challenge to ask among its peers for some pieces of data. The prover will need to figure out how to get that data and respond to that challenge.
To support different backup solutions, we can implement a plug-in architecture similar to terraform, where terraform provider is a separate program that runs and communicates with the main terraform through rpc call. we can provide a few provider providers such as restic backup, borg backup, ebs snapshot etc.
There are 2 kinds of data in our specific setup
1. Level DB data
This is straightforward to easily mount a backup snapshot into disk, and have a simple Go program that reads the key and returns its value. Or restore an EBS snapshot.
CometBFT, currently in our config, uses this https://github.com/syndtr/goleveldb which is fairly simple to write a small program that opens the data (either from snapshot mount through FUSE or an EBS volume) and fetch the key.
2. Postgres Data
Similarly as above, with Postgres data, the prover can restore an instance from their snapshot data. Then it can query for the relevant data, and then shutdown the postgres instance. For non-cloud backup solutions like pgbackrest or pgbarman, we can pick one and write a provider to handle restoration, read the data out.
For picking a data point out to compare, the prover can try to pick the one that has not changed during the backup window. Example we pick a key or a row that has not changed in 24hours, then regardless which time the backup is taken during the day, it should have that value.
What do you think ?

- toggle quoted message Show quoted textAs discussed in the last weekly ops meeting, I would like to share a few approaches to bring this up for discussion again.In the new CometBFT we are going to use Postgres as storage instead of LevelDB so we can focus all the effort on proving Postgres data. If we do need to perform that, LevelDB is actually quite easy to prove because they are just key<-> values with limited functionality and can easily restore a snapshot and mount. Backup tooling like `restic snapshot` even allow to mount a snapshot and we can read the leveldb file with any client example https://github.com/liderman/leveldb-cli/blob/master/main.goFor Postgres, the primary challenge is access postgres backup data in a timely manner without restoring it into a real database.
There are however many modern Postgres tools that allow us to export Postgres data as CSV or Parquet file to object storage and allow us to query these directly using SQL interfaces without the need to restore the data to a Postgres instance.
The process is very similar to a full pg_dump, but instead of exporting to CSV/SQL or custom format, we export the data to Parquet files, and the file can be stored on object storage like S3/GCS.
Example tooling: https://github.com/CrunchyData/pg_parquet/ https://bnmoch3.org/notes/2025/postgres-iceberg-sync-duckdb/These parquet files can then be query directly using SQL with tool such as AWS Athena(https://docs.aws.amazon.com/athena/latest/ug/columnar-storage.html), Druio, DuckDB(https://duckdb.org/docs/stable/guides/network_cloud_storage/s3_import.html)We then can write a service that performs SQL queries to verify data consistency between the backup. If we take backup daily, we will need to craft a query that has not been modified in say the last 24 hours, then no matter when a backup was taken, as long as it's in the 24 hours window, the backup is correct and will be consistent across all SV.Example, today is 2025-04-15. We can ask "give me a list of transfers between 2025-04-13 -> 2025-04-14. Then no matter when the backup is taken on 2025-04-15, the data will be consistent.Let me know if this idea is sound and we can expand further into some real http service that can perform this kind of query.On Wed, Mar 19, 2025 at 9:31 AM Yiannis Varelas <y@...> wrote:Hi all - just bringing this up again since we have now gone through the devnet reset.@Wayne I believe 2/3 is what we need yes.@Ryan this is an excellent idea.
